moin,

have you configured the routes at your gateway?
you need a route to that gateway:
ip route 0.0.0.0 0.0.0.0 170.1.193.254
the default gateway config on the switch doesn't work if you enable ip routing.

have you configured the routes at your gateway(170.1.193.254)? something like:
ip route 172.168.1.1 255.255.255.0 170.1.193.3
ip route 182.28.103.1 255.255.0.0 170.1.193.3
ip route 182.21.47.1 255.255.255.128 170.1.193.3
